Can a Virginia Polytechnic Institute and State University tutor help me prepare for tests?
Preparing for a test —whether it's a unit test or a final exam —can put a lot of stress on students. If you don't know where to start with your review or if you feel you need more practice to improve your skills in a particular subject, taking advantage of Virginia Tech tutoring can be a great way to gain access to an expert mentor to help you with your test prep.
Your Virginia Polytechnic Institute and State University tutoring instructor can assess your strengths and weaknesses and design a customized study plan that could help improve your skills in time for your test. They can also use a variety of teaching methods that use multiple senses (sight, hearing, touch) that could make it easier for you to take in information and retain what you've learned. For example, your private instructor can show you how to use mind maps or spaced repetition flashcards with audio to remember important terms or concepts covered on your test.
Aside from helping you with the content of your exam, your Virginia Tech tutoring instructor can also share useful test-taking techniques that could help you become more efficient on exam day. For instance, your instructor can work with you on practice questions and train you on how to find keywords so you can quickly eliminate incorrect answers in a multiple-choice question.
